Using my pocket PC for sketching
      #440351 - 05/14/05 09:34 PM

I am intending to get Deepsky so I can start logging my observations. Also going to use my pocket PC to sketch my drawings, as it's so useful to use, and better then paper. There are some sketching programs, and one of the best I found was pencil box delux. Which can be downloaded from pocketgear.

There used to be a very good logbook for pocket pc and there is a demo you can download from pocketgear.com with limited sketching ablitity with it, but this program seems to be no longer supported, so cannot regisiter it. With Deepsky the good thing is it now includes pocket deepsky, so can make notes of your observations, and combined with a good sketch program for your pocket pc, much better than using a paper log book.

There does not seem to be any astronomical logbooks for a pocket pc anymore, which is a shame, as a good pocket logbook with pocket pc would allow quick note taking and sketching, more conventant then using a note book.

The great thing about using pencilbox is it's like using colour pencils in real life, so makes sketching easier to do than using many of the other sketching programs.

There is also a free version of pencil box also for those interested in trying to use your pocket pc to make sketches.

I have not heard of pencil Box.
I use PhatPad for sketching on my Handheld PC(but no astro sketching). I haven't loaded the latest update, but the original version did not have shading capablity (transparent) which may be a big problem for "real" sketching vs. the cartooning I do.
